
The whole team, Kate, Kristin, Molly and Andrea, recap a few of their favorite episodes from this past season and answer listener questions. They chat about their mixed feelings for copy editors, the discussions they had about a recent Instagram story about recipe writing rigor and call out what they learned from a few recent interviews. The hosts then open up the mail bag and give their answers on recipe adaption and attribution, the idea of 'picking brains', including previously published dishes in a book and share how they add some flourish to their own book signings. Before signing off they shout-out an upcoming virtual event and share a note about what listeners can expect during our summer hiatus. See you in September for Season 10!
